Attorneys Michelle Laubin, Christine Sullivan, Carolyn Dugas and John Khalil recently acted as peer reviewers for a new publication titled “Legal Resource for School Health Services”. The reference book addresses legal issues impacting all who provide health services in schools, counsel schools, and are responsible for school health services programs. The publication covers legal implications of commonly encountered issues and presents legal resources and references that can be applied to practice and policy development. Over 50 topics are included including information on federal laws, compliance, medication administration, professional licensure and malpractice, minor rights, mental health and more.
